PDA

フルバージョンを見る: htaccessの問題8wayrunmedia



Santori
15-11-10, 18:23
こんにちはマイケル !私はまだあなたの mod を使用して、それは素晴らしい !Mod を置くし、今他の言語は動作しませんので、問題があります。このトピックがない場合ここで、私はお詫び申し上げます。私はこの mod を seo の仕事に htaccess ファイルにコードを追加したこの mod でこの mod8WayRun.Com - メディア ライブラリ - vBulletin.org フォーラム (http://www.vbulletin.org/forum/showthread.php?t=240677&highlight=media) をインストールしてが他の言語で動作しません。他の言語の一部に触れられていません。上記の新しいコードを加えただけ、何かがあることだと思う mal:este は私の ht のアクセス: *-# 有効期限が切れる
<ifModule mod_expires.c>
ExpiresActive OnExpiresDefault「アクセス プラス 1 秒」ExpiresByType テキストと html「アクセス プラス 1 秒」ExpiresByType イメージ ・ gif 3456000 秒の「アクセス」ExpiresByType イメージ/jpeg 3456000 秒の「アクセス」ExpiresByType イメージ ・ png 3456000 秒の「アクセス」ExpiresByType 本文・ css に」アクセス プラス 3456000 秒」ExpiresByType テキスト/javascript 3456000 秒の「アクセス」ExpiresByType アプリケーション ・ javascript 3456000 秒の「アクセス」ExpiresByType アプリケーション ・ x-javascript"アクセス プラス 3456000 秒」
</ifModule>

##圧縮
<ifmodule mod_headers.c>
<ifmodule mod_deflate.c>
[AddOutputFilterByType を収縮させるテキスト、html テキスト ・ css テキストと xml アプリケーション ・ x-javascriptBrowserMatch ^ Mozilla/4 gzip-だけ-テキスト ・ htmlBrowserMatch ^ Mozilla/4/.0[678] 非 gzipBrowserMatch/bMSIE ! いいえ gzip ! gzip-だけ-テキストと html
</ifmodule>
</ifmodule>

##書き換えます
<ifmodule mod_rewrite.c>
行う RewriteEngine onOptions + FollowSymlinksRewriteCond % {REQUEST_FILENAME} - s [または] RewriteCond % {REQUEST_FILENAME} - l [または] RewriteCond % {REQUEST_FILENAME} - dRewriteRule を行う ^. *$ - NC [L] # Media LibraryReWriteRule ^ メディア ・ m(/d+) *$ media.php にタグ? か = tags_edit & 半ば $ 1 [QSA] ReWriteRule = ^ メディア ・ m(/d+)。 */$ media.php を編集? か = details_edit & 半ば $ 1 [QSA] ReWriteRule = ^ メディア ・ m(/d+)。 */$ media.php レポート? か = レポート & 半ば $ 1 [QSA] ReWriteRule = ^ media/m(/d+).*/c(/d+)$ media.php? か = comment_edit & cmt =$ 2 [QSA] ReWriteRule ^ media/m(/d+).*/p(/d+)。 *$ media.php? か = 詳細 & 半ば $ 1 & pid = =$ 2]。(か (media.php? か = タグ & tid =$ 1 [QSA] ReWriteRule ^ media/results/(.*) media.php? か = 結果 & クエリ =$ 1 [QSA] ReWriteRule ^ media/advresults/(.*) media.php? か = advresults & クエリ =$ 1 [QSA]行うを行うを行うを行うを行う (ReWriteRule_^media/letter/(.*) media.php? は = 文字とクエリ =$ 1 [QSA] ReWriteRule ^ メディア ・ browse.* media.php? か = [QSA] ReWriteRule を参照 ^ メディア ・.* media.php? は = [QSA] ReWriteRule を検索 ^ メディア ・ random.* media.php? か = ランダム [QSA] ReWriteRule ^ メディア ・ submit.* media.php? は = [QSA] ReWriteRule を送信 ^ メディア ・ tagcloud.* media.php? するタグクラウド [QSA] = ReWriteRule ^ メディア ・ playlists.* media.php? か再生リスト [QSA] = ReWriteRule ^ メディア ・ pcreate.* media.php? か = playlists_create [QSA] ReWriteRule ^ メディア ・ pmine.* media.php? か = playlists_mine [QSA] ReWriteRule ^ メディア ・ favorites.* media.php? か = お気に入り [QSA] ReWriteRule ^ メディア ・ subscriptions.* media.php? か = サブスクリプション]かを行う [QSA] ReWriteRule を行う ^ media/admin/edit/s(/d+) * media.php? か = admin_host_edit & sid =$ 1 [QSA] ReWriteRule ^ media/admin/delete/s(/d+)。 * media.php? か = admin_host_delete & sid =$ 1 [QSA] ReWriteRule ^ media/admin/export/s(/d+)。 * media.php? か = admin_host_export & sid =$ 1 [QSA] ReWriteRule ^ media/admin/(/w+)。 * media.php? は admin_ ドル 1 [QSA] = # Media ライブラリからビデオ DirectoryRewriteCond % {QUERY_STRING} c viewdetails & videoid =(/d+) RewriteRule = ^ ビデオ ・ .php$ media.php?do=details&mid=%1RewriteCond % {QUERY_STRING} viewcategory & categoryid =(/d+) RewriteRule ^ ビデオ ・ .php$ media.php?。do = カテゴリ & cid % 1rewritecond% {QUERY_STRING} viewuser & ユーザー id =(/d+) RewriteRule = ^ ビデオ ・ .php$ media.php?do=user&uid=%1RewriteCond % {QUERY_STRING} viewtag & タグ =(.*) RewriteRule ^ ビデオ ・ .php$ media.php?do=tag&tid=%1ReWriteRule ^ ビデオ ・ .php$ media.php # ForumRewriteRule ^ スレッド ・. * showthread.php [QSA] RewriteRule ^ フォーラム ・. * forumdisplay.php [QSA] RewriteRule ^ ブログ ・. * blog.php [QSA] ReWriteRule ^ エントリ ・. * entry.php [QSA] RewriteCond % {REQUEST_FILENAME} - s [または] RewriteCond % {REQUEST_FILENAME} - l [または] RewriteCond % {REQUEST_FILENAME} - dRewriteRule ^. *$-[NC][、L] # MVCRewriteRule ^ (?: (.))*?)(?:/|($) を行う (. * | ドル) $1.php? r =$ 2 [QSA]
</ifmodule>

# 次の行のコメント ('#' を先頭に追加) 注 mod_rewrite 機能。 # Please を無効にする: まだ url を停止によるで vBSEO コントロール パネルを書き換えます # でハックを無効にする必要があります。RewriteEngine にいくつかのサーバー # (先頭のライセンス認証を削除 '#') を有効にするのには、Rewritebase ディレクティブを必要とする # Please 注: 有効にすると、パスを含める必要があります # を vB のルート フォルダーに (すなわち RewriteBase ・ フォーラム ・) # RewriteBase ・ # RewriteCond % {HTTP_HOST} ! ^www/.aquaterraria/.com#RewriteRule (. *) http://www.yourdomain.com/forums/$1 [L、R 301 =] RewriteRule ^ ((urllist|sitemap_). * ・. ())((xml|txt)(/.gz)?) を行う$ vbseo_sitemap/vbseo_getsitemap.php か? サイトマップ =$ 1 [L] RewriteRule ^/か。(af|sq|ar|be|bg|ca|zh-CN|hr|cs|da|nl|en|et|tl|fi|fr|gl|de|el|iw|hi|hu|is|id|ga|it|ja|ko|lv|lt|mk|ms|mt|no|fa|pl|pt|ro|ru|sr|sk|sl|es|sw|sv|zh-TW|th|tr|uk|vi|cy|yi)/$batch vbenterprisetranslator_seo.php か? vbet_lang =$ 1 & リダイレクト = ・ [L、QSA] RewriteRule ^ ・?(af|sq|ar|be|bg|ca|zh-CN|hr|cs|da|nl|en|et|tl|fi|fr|gl|de|el|iw|hi|hu|is|id|ga|it|ja|ko|lv|lt|mk|ms|mt|no|fa|pl|pt|ro|ru|sr|sk|sl|es|sw|sv|zh-TW|th|tr|uk|vi|cy|yi)/(.*) を行うか?$ vbenterprisetranslator_seo.php? vbet_lang $ 1 = & リダイレクト = $ 2 [L、QSA] RewriteCond % {REQUEST_URI} !(admincp、|modcp、|vbseo_sitemap、|cron)RewriteRule ^ ((archive/)? (.))(((*/.php(/.*)?)) をか$ vbenterprisetranslator_seo.php [L、QSA] RewriteCond % {REQUEST_FILENAME} ! - fRewriteCond {REQUEST_FILENAME} ! - dRewriteCond % {REQUEST_FILENAME} ! ^ (admincp|modcp|clientscript|cpstyles|images)/RewriteRule $ vbenterprisetranslator_seo.php [L、QSA] RewriteCond % {REQUEST_URI} !(|cron|vbseo_sitemap、|modcp、admincp)RewriteRule ^ ((archive/)? (.))(((*/.php(/.*)?)) をか$ vbseo.php [L、QSA] RewriteCond % {REQUEST_FILENAME} ! - fRewriteCond {REQUEST_FILENAME} ! - dRewriteCond % {REQUEST_FILENAME} !/(admincp|modcp|clientscript|cpstyles|images)/RewriteRule ^(.+)$ vbseo.php [L、QSA] *-

mateuszr
17-11-10, 10:07
私は働くことは、あなたがvBETルールと返信AFTER httaccess規則を貼り付けることが示唆された

スレッドは、"統合"セクションに"バグ報告"から移動

kamilkurczak
17-11-10, 11:44
そのファイルの一部は(htaccessのルール)このMODからでしょうか?

Santori
20-11-10, 01:33
申し訳ありませんが、これは元の部品vBETのルールです。

#(先頭に'#'を追加)以下の行をコメント
#mod_rewriteの機能を無効にする。
#注意:あなたはまだでハックを無効にする必要があります。
#urlを停止するにはvBSEOコントロールパネルが書き換えられます。
RewriteEngineで

#一部のサーバでは、にRewritebaseディレクティブが必要です
#有効(アクティブにするには先頭に'#'を削除)
#注意:有効にした場合、パスを含める必要があります
#ルートVBフォルダ(例:RewriteBase /フォーラム/)へ
#RewriteBase /

#RewriteCondの%{HTTP_HOST}!^ WWW \\。aquaterraria \\。com
#するRewriteRule(.*)http://www.yourdomain.com/forums/ $ 1 [L、R = 301]

するRewriteRule ^((にて応対| sitemap_).* \\(XML |。。TXT)(\\ GZ)?)$ vbseo_sitemap / vbseo_getsitemap.phpサイトマップ= $ 1 [L]?
するRewriteRule vbenterprisetranslator_seo.php?vbet_lang = $ 1&リダイレクトされた= / [L、QSA]
するRewriteRule vbenterprisetranslator_seo.php?vbet_lang = $ 1&リダイレクトされた= / $ 2 [L、QSA]

RewriteCondで%{REQUEST_URI}!(admincp / | modcp / | vbseo_sitemap / | cronの)
するRewriteRule ^((アーカイブ/)?(.* \\。phpの(/.*)?))$ vbenterprisetranslator_seo.php [L、QSA]

RewriteCondで%{REQUEST_FILENAME}!- F
RewriteCondで%{REQUEST_FILENAME}!- D
RewriteCondで%{REQUEST_FILENAME} ^!(admincp | modcp | clientscript | cpstyles |画像)/
のRewriteRule $ vbenterprisetranslator_seo.php [L、QSA]
RewriteCondで%{REQUEST_URI}!(admincp / | modcp / |クーロン| vbseo_sitemap)
するRewriteRule ^((アーカイブ/)?(.* \\。phpの(/.*)?))$ vbseo.php [L、QSA]

RewriteCondで%{REQUEST_FILENAME}!- F
RewriteCondで%{REQUEST_FILENAME}!- D
RewriteCondで%{REQUEST_FILENAME} /!(admincp | modcp | clientscript | cpstyles |画像)/
のRewriteRule ^(.+)$ vbseo.php [L、QSA]
そして、これは新しい部分です。

##有効期限
<IfModuleのmod_expires.c>
ExpiresActive Onが
ExpiresDefault"アクセスプラス1秒"
ExpiresByTypeはtext / html"アクセスプラス1秒"
ExpiresByType image / gifの"アクセスプラス3456000秒"
ExpiresByType image / jpeg"にアクセスプラス3456000秒"
ExpiresByType image / pngの"アクセスプラス3456000秒"
ExpiresByTypeはtext / css"アクセスプラス3456000秒"
ExpiresByTypeは、text / javascriptの"アクセスプラス3456000秒"
ExpiresByTypeアプリケーション/ javascriptの"アクセスプラス3456000秒"
ExpiresByTypeアプリケーション/ x -ジャバスクリプト"アクセスプラス3456000秒"
の</ IfModule>

##圧縮
<IfModuleのmod_headers.c>
<IfModuleのmod_deflate.c>
テキスト/ htmlをtext / cssのtext / xmlのアプリケーション/ x - javascriptをDEFLATEずつ書く
BrowserMatchは^ Mozillaの/ 4上手く対処
BrowserMatchは^ Mozillaの/ 4 \\ .0 [678] no - gzipと
BrowserMatchは\\ bMSIE!no - gzipと!上手く対処
の</ IfModule>
の</ IfModule>

##書き換えます
<IfModuleのmod_rewrite.c>
RewriteEngineで
オプション+ FollowSymLinksを

RewriteCondで%{REQUEST_FILENAME} - S [OR]
RewriteCond%{REQUEST_FILENAME} - L [OR]
RewriteCondで%{REQUEST_FILENAME} - D
するRewriteRule ^ .* $ - [NC、L]

#メディア図書館
のRewriteRule ^メディア/ M(\\ dは+).*/タグ$ media.php?= tags_edit&ミッド= $ 1 [QSA]を行う
のRewriteRule ^メディア/ M(\\ dは+).*/編集$ media.php?行う= details_edit&ミッド= $ 1 [QSA]
のRewriteRule ^メディア/ M(\\ dは+).*/レポート$ media.php?行う=レポート&ミッド= $ 1 [QSA]
のRewriteRule ^メディア/ M(\\ dは+).*/ C(\\ d +)は$ media.php?= comment_edit&CMT = $ 2 [QSA]を行う
のRewriteRule ^メディア/ M(\\ dは+).*/ P(\\ dは+).*$ media.php?行う=詳細&ミッド= $ 1&PID = $ 2 [QSA]
のRewriteRule ^メディア/ M(\\ D +).* media.php?行う=詳細&ミッド= $ 1 [QSA]
のRewriteRule ^メディア/ P(\\ dは+).*/編集$ media.php?行う= playlist_edit&PID = $ 1 [QSA]
のRewriteRule、^メディア/ P(\\ D +).* media.php?行う=プレイリスト&PID = $ 1 [QSA]
のRewriteRule、^メディア/ C(\\ D +).* media.php?行う=カテゴリ&CID = 1ドル[QSA]は
のRewriteRule ^メディア/ U(\\ D +).* media.php?行う=ユーザ&UID = $ 1 [QSA]
のRewriteRule ^メディア/タグ/(.*) media.php?行う=タグ&tidは1ドル= [QSA]
のRewriteRule ^メディア/結果/(.*) media.php?行う=結果&クエリ1米ドル= [QSA]
のRewriteRule ^メディア/ advresults /(.*) media.php?行う= advresults&クエリ= $ 1 [QSA]
のRewriteRule ^メディア/文字/(.*) media.php?=手紙を行うと、クエリ= $ 1 [QSA]
のRewriteRule ^メディア/ブラウズ.* media.php?=ブラウズ[QSA]を行う
のRewriteRule ^メディア/検索.* media.php?=検索[QSA]を行う
のRewriteRule ^メディア/ランダム.* media.php?行う=ランダム[QSA]
のRewriteRule ^メディア/提出.* media.php?行う=送信[QSA]
のRewriteRule ^メディア/ tagcloud .* media.php?= tagcloud [QSA]を行う
のRewriteRule ^メディア/プレイリスト.* media.php?か=プレイリストは[QSA]
のRewriteRule ^メディア/ pcreate .* media.php?行う= playlists_create [QSA]
のRewriteRule ^メディア/ pmine .* media.php?= playlists_mine [QSA]を行う
のRewriteRule ^メディア/お気に入り.* media.php?か=のお気に入りは[QSA]
のRewriteRule ^メディア/サブスクリプション.* media.php?行う=サブスクリプション[QSA]
のRewriteRule ^メディア/ adminの/編集/秒(\\ D +).* media.php?行う= admin_host_edit&SID = $ 1 [QSA]
のRewriteRule ^メディア/ adminの/削除/秒(\\ D +).* media.php?行う= admin_host_delete&SID = $ 1 [QSA]
のRewriteRule ^メディア/管理者/輸出/秒(\\ D +).* media.php?行う= admin_host_export&SID = $ 1 [QSA]
のRewriteRule ^メディア/管理/(\\ W +).* media.php?行う= admin_ $ 1 [QSA]

#メディアライブラリビデオのディレクトリから
RewriteCond%は{QUERY_STRING} = viewdetails&videoid =(A \\ D +)を行う
のRewriteRule ^ビデオ\\。phpの$ media.php?=細部を行います&ミッド=%1
RewriteCond%{QUERY_STRING} viewcategory&区分コード=(\\ d +は)
のRewriteRule ^ビデオ\\。phpの$ media.php?か=カテゴリ&CID =%1
RewriteCondで%{QUERY_STRING} viewuser&USERID =(\\ d +は)
のRewriteRule ^ビデオ\\。phpの$ media.php?=ユーザ&UID =%1の操作を行います。
RewriteCondで%{QUERY_STRING} viewtag&タグ=(.*)
のRewriteRule ^ビデオ\\。phpの$ media.php?か=タグ&TID =%1
のRewriteRule ^ビデオ、\\。phpの$ media.php

#フォーラム
のRewriteRule ^スレッド/ .* showthread.php [QSA]
のRewriteRule ^フォーラム/ .* forumdisplay.php [QSA]
のRewriteRule ^ブログ/ .* blog.php [QSA]
のRewriteRule ^エントリー/ .* entry.php [QSA]

RewriteCondで%{REQUEST_FILENAME} - S [OR]
RewriteCond%{REQUEST_FILENAME} - L [OR]
RewriteCondで%{REQUEST_FILENAME} - D
するRewriteRule ^ .* $ - [NC、L]

#MVC
のRewriteRule ^(?.*?)(?:/|$))(.*|$)$ $ 1.php?R = $ 2 [QSA]
の</ IfModule>

私はオリジナルの後に新しいルールを貼り付けるしようとしましたが、動作しません。あなたが助けることができるなら、私は、何の問題もそれに感謝しない、場合ではない。よろしく

kamilkurczak
22-11-10, 09:08
[OK]を、私はそれを統合しようとします。

vBET
30-11-10, 15:29
私たちのルールの後にそれを置くと動作しません - 私たちのルールは、[L]を使用しています - 最後のルールを。 vBETのルールの前にそれらを利用するようにしてください。

Automatic Translations (Powered by Google, Microsoft®, Yandex, SDL Language Cloud, IBM Watson and Apertium):
AfrikaansAlbanianArabicBelarusianBulgarianCatalanChineseCroatianCzechDanishDutchEnglishEstonianFilipinoFinnishFrenchGalicianGermanGreekHaitian CreoleHebrewHindiHungarianIcelandicIndonesianIrishItalianJapaneseKoreanLatvianLithuanianMacedonianMalayMalteseNorwegianPersianPolishPortugueseRomanianRussianSerbianSlovakSlovenianSpanishSwahiliSwedishTaiwaneseThaiTurkishUkrainianVietnameseWelshYiddish
vBET 4.10.1 supports automatic translations